Abstract

The glycosylation of pterostilbene by cultured plant cells of Phytolacca americana gave pterostilbene 4-O-′-D-glucoside. Both pterostilbene and its 4'-O-β-Dglucoside induced type XVII collagen expression in the EpiDermFT EFT-400 human skin cell model. Pterostilbene 4′-O-β-D-glucoside strongly induced type XVII collagen expression rather than pterostilbene.
